SLIER MUHAMMAD versus NASREEN AKHTAR


The Guardian and Wards Act 1890 Section 25 Constitution of Pakistan (1973), Article 199 Constitutional application for the minor welfare of a minor man divorced the woman who was the mother of a minor girl who was in the custody of a minor girl. Posted at a distant place and did not take care of the minor, despite the decree of the minor buffalo, the giving of the minor girl to the minor, who contracted the second marriage, would not be in her welfare, but it was of the minor. His welfare would remain in custody if his mother was a minor in a local school and interrupting her custody would affect her education career. The courts below rightly said that the custody of a minor girl with her mother was appropriate and the courts did not find so much in her welfare. Not subject to any legal weakness, the exercise of its constitutional jurisdiction cannot be interfered with by the High Court.
